The miniaturization of the driving circuit of ultrasonic motor is becoming more and more important in the ultrasonic application system. Based on the 0.35 μm bipolarcomplementary metal oxide semiconductordouble diffused metal oxide semiconductor(BCD) process, a monolithic integrated ultrasonic motor driving circuit chip is designed in this work. The chip consists of a nonsynchronous peak current mode boost circuit and two halfbridge drivers. The peak current mode boost circuit provides power for the halfbridge driver. Two square waves with the phase difference of 90° which output from two halfbridge drivers with adaptive deadtime controller are used to drive the ultrasonic motor.
